Choose a Higher Deductible Plan
One of the most effective ways to lower your health insurance premiums is to choose a plan with a higher deductible. In exchange for paying more out of pocket when you need care, you will typically pay lower monthly premiums. If you are generally healthy and don’t expect to need frequent medical care, this can be a good option for saving money.

Consider a Health Savings Account (HSA)
If you choose a high-deductible health plan (HDHP), you may be eligible for a Health Savings Account (HSA). An HSA allows you to set aside pre-tax money for medical expenses, which can help offset the cost of higher deductibles. In addition, the money you contribute to an HSA can grow tax-free and be used for future healthcare costs.

Look for Subsidies and Assistance Programs
If you have a lower income, you may qualify for subsidies or assistance programs that can help lower your health insurance premiums. For example, through the Health Insurance Marketplace, individuals and families with lower incomes may be eligible for tax credits to reduce the cost of their monthly premiums. It’s important to check your eligibility for these programs to save money on your coverage.
